Abstracts are invited for Oral and Scientific Exhibits at the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re, Melbourne from 4-7 October 2007. The Program Committee encourages the submissions
as these are an integral part of the scientific meeting.

Since 1984, the firm of Varian has kindly donated an annual cash prize
and a plaque to be awarded for the best paper prepared and presented by
a Student Member in the Radiation Oncology section of the Scientific Program
of the Annual Meeting of the College. This year the cash prize is $1,500
and the winner will also receive a return airfare to the College ASM next
year. The prize will be judged on the following criteria; originality,
hypothesis generation, methodology, amount of work undertaken, analysis
of results, presentation, clinical importance and response to questions.
The abstract should include and indication of the background/hypothesis,
methods/patients involved and results and conclusions.
This prize is awarded to the poster by a Radiation Oncologists which
is judged to have made the most significant contribution to the scientific
program. The prize is valued at $1,000 and is sponsored by the Faculty
of Radiation Oncology
